HR Compliance Officer: Ensures adherence to employment laws and regulations, reducing legal risks for organizations.

Employee Relations Specialist: Manages workplace conflicts and fosters positive employee-employer relationships.

Workplace Mediator: Resolves disputes and promotes harmonious work environments through legal mediation techniques.

Legal HR Consultant: Provides expert advice on HR policies aligned with employment law and best practices.

Employment Law Advisor: Specializes in interpreting and applying employment legislation to support HR decision-making.

Course content

• Employment Law and Workplace Regulations
• Human Resource Management Principles
• Legal Frameworks for Employee Relations
• Contract Law and HR Policies
• Workplace Health and Safety Compliance
• Discrimination and Equality Law
• Dispute Resolution and Mediation Techniques
• Data Protection and Privacy in HR
• Recruitment and Termination Legalities
• Ethical Practices in Human Resource Management
